Last Layer Skip is a very lucky case when the cube comes together as solved after the completion of the first two layers. Keaton Ellis had solved the cube in 5.09 seconds, once again breaking the record. The best cubers solve the first two layers in approximately 3.5 seconds. A selection of these puzzles are chosen as official events of the WCA. The most famous of these puzzles is the Rubiks Cube, invented by professor Rubik from Hungary. Just like every other record that seemed unbreakable, one day this one will be broken as well. The World Cube Association governs competitions for mechanical puzzles that are operated by twisting groups of pieces, commonly known as twisty puzzles. New Rubiks Cube record: Yusheng Du () - 3.47 seconds Published: NovemYusheng Du () shaved off 0.75 seconds from the record of Feliks Zemdegs (4. Yusheng Du is currently the 60th best cuber on the World, according to his average 3x3 record. ![]() Then comes a relatively unknown cuber who has never solved the cube under 6 seconds on a competition and beats it with 3/4 seconds with the very first official Sub-4 ever. The first Sub-4 is definitely a huge surprise because the previous 4.22s record by Feliks Zemdegs seemed to be unbreakable and it was expected to be standing for years.
